Optimize your website for mobile devices. Mobile-friendly websites are essential for both user experience and SEO.
In today’s mobile-driven world, optimizing your website for mobile devices is no longer a luxury but a necessity. With the increasing number of people accessing the internet through smartphones and tablets, having a mobile-friendly website has become essential for both user experience and SEO.
User Experience:
When visitors access your website on their mobile devices, they expect a seamless and user-friendly experience. A mobile-friendly website adjusts its layout and content to fit different screen sizes, ensuring that users can navigate easily without having to zoom in or scroll horizontally. By providing a responsive design, you enhance user satisfaction and keep them engaged with your content.
A positive user experience leads to increased time spent on your site, lower bounce rates, and higher chances of conversions. On the other hand, if users struggle to navigate your non-mobile-friendly website, they are more likely to leave frustrated and seek alternatives elsewhere.
Search Engine Optimization (SEO):
Optimizing your website for mobile devices is not only beneficial for users but also plays a crucial role in SEO. Search engines like Google prioritize mobile-friendly websites in their search results. In fact, Google has implemented mobile-first indexing, meaning it primarily uses the mobile version of websites for indexing and ranking.
Having a mobile-friendly website improves your chances of ranking higher in search engine results pages (SERPs) when users search from their smartphones or tablets. It demonstrates that you provide a positive user experience across all devices, which aligns with search engines’ goal of delivering the most relevant and user-friendly results.
Additionally, Google explicitly labels mobile-friendly websites in its search results, making it easier for users to identify sites that will provide an optimal browsing experience on their devices. This label can improve click-through rates and drive more organic traffic to your site.

Utilize internal linking to create a strong structure for your website that helps both users and search engines navigate it easily.
Utilize Internal Linking: Enhancing User Experience and SEO Efforts
When it comes to website development and SEO, one often overlooked yet powerful tip is the utilization of internal linking. Internal linking refers to the practice of connecting different pages within your website through hyperlinks. This strategy not only helps users navigate your site more easily but also provides numerous benefits for search engine optimization.
One of the main advantages of internal linking is that it improves user experience. By strategically placing relevant internal links throughout your content, you can guide visitors to related topics, additional resources, or relevant product/service pages. This enables them to explore your website further, find valuable information, and stay engaged longer. A well-structured internal linking system allows users to navigate seamlessly between pages, reducing bounce rates and increasing the chances of conversions.
From an SEO perspective, internal linking plays a crucial role in establishing a strong website structure. Search engine crawlers use links to discover and index web pages. By interlinking your content effectively, you provide search engines with clear pathways to navigate through your site’s architecture. This helps search engines understand the hierarchy and importance of different pages on your website.
Internal linking also distributes link equity or authority throughout your site. When you link from a high-authority page to another page within your site, you pass on some of that authority, signaling its importance to search engines. This can potentially boost the ranking potential of linked pages in search engine results.
To make the most out of internal linking for both users and SEO purposes, consider these best practices:
- Use descriptive anchor text: Instead of using generic phrases like “click here,” utilize keywords or descriptive phrases that accurately reflect the content being linked.
- Prioritize relevance: Link related content together to provide a logical flow for users and help search engines understand thematic connections between different pages.
- Avoid excessive linking: While internal links are beneficial, avoid overdoing it as it may confuse users and dilute the impact of each link. Focus on quality rather than quantity.
- Update and audit your links regularly: As your website evolves, ensure that your internal links remain up-to-date and functional. Broken or outdated links can negatively impact user experience and SEO efforts.

Make sure all images have descriptive alt tags so they are optimized properly for SEO purposes
When it comes to website development and SEO, every little detail matters. One often overlooked aspect is the use of descriptive alt tags for images. Alt tags, also known as alternative text, serve a dual purpose: they provide a description of the image for visually impaired users and help search engines understand what the image represents.
Including descriptive alt tags is crucial for optimizing images for SEO purposes. Search engines rely on text-based cues to understand and rank web content, and alt tags provide valuable context about the images on your website. By using relevant keywords in your alt tags, you can improve your chances of ranking higher in image search results.
When creating alt tags, it’s important to be concise yet descriptive. Instead of using generic terms like “image123.jpg,” opt for specific descriptions that accurately represent the content of the image. For example, if you have an image of a red bicycle on your website, an appropriate alt tag could be “Red bicycle with white basket parked by a river.”
Not only do descriptive alt tags enhance your website’s accessibility and user experience, but they also contribute to overall SEO optimization. By providing search engines with clear information about your images, you increase their visibility in search results and attract more organic traffic to your site.
Remember to include alt tags for all images on your website, including logos, product photos, infographics, and illustrations. This practice ensures that every visual element contributes positively to both user experience and SEO efforts.
